Michael A. Fonseca is a scholar working on Electrical and Electronic Engineering, Biomedical Engineering and Cardiology and Cardiovascular Medicine. According to data from OpenAlex, Michael A. Fonseca has authored 4 papers receiving a total of 356 indexed citations (citations by other indexed papers that have themselves been cited), including 2 papers in Electrical and Electronic Engineering, 2 papers in Biomedical Engineering and 1 paper in Cardiology and Cardiovascular Medicine. Recurrent topics in Michael A. Fonseca's work include Advanced MEMS and NEMS Technologies (1 paper), Acoustic Wave Resonator Technologies (1 paper) and Advanced Sensor and Energy Harvesting Materials (1 paper). Michael A. Fonseca is often cited by papers focused on Advanced MEMS and NEMS Technologies (1 paper), Acoustic Wave Resonator Technologies (1 paper) and Advanced Sensor and Energy Harvesting Materials (1 paper). Michael A. Fonseca collaborates with scholars based in United States. Michael A. Fonseca's co-authors include Mark G. Allen, M. von Arx, Jennifer M. English, John A. White, Ninad Desai, Fadi Nahab, Farrokh Ayazi, Jin‐Woo Park and Haoran Wen and has published in prestigious journals such as Stroke, Journal of Microelectromechanical Systems and SMARTech Repository (Georgia Institute of Technology).

1.
Desai, Ninad, Jin‐Woo Park, Haoran Wen, et al.. (2025). Abstract WMP107: Carotid Artery Assessment via Blood Acoustic Signatures Captured by a Wearable Seismometer Patch. Stroke. 56(Suppl_1).
2.
Fonseca, Michael A.. (2008). Development of Implantable Wireless Pressure Sensors for Chronic Disease Management. SMARTech Repository (Georgia Institute of Technology). 1 indexed citations
3.
Fonseca, Michael A., et al.. (2006). FLEXIBLE WIRELESS PASSIVE PRESSURE SENSORS FOR BIOMEDICAL APPLICATIONS. 37–42. 90 indexed citations
4.
Fonseca, Michael A., Jennifer M. English, M. von Arx, & Mark G. Allen. (2002). Wireless micromachined ceramic pressure sensor for high-temperature applications. Journal of Microelectromechanical Systems. 11(4). 337–343. 265 indexed citations
